Subject: Magical holy null-move

Author: Georg Langrath

Date: 02:33:53 02/04/00


3n4/8/pppN4/k7/2P5/1K6/P7/8 w

About this position. Fritz 5.32 can't find this mate in three. Fritz 6 can find
it in time mode, but not in analyze mode. In my opinion that is an ugly bug.

Then somebody says that it is a null-move problem. Then no more with that. When
it is a null-move problem is seems as it is acceptable in the world of
chesscomputers and no more to add. In my opinion it is still very ugly that a
modern chesscomputer can't find a mate in three.

I think that it is done before, but can somebody explain this mystical null-move
so also an amateur understands? I think it is some kind of holy magic power that
you must not heckle.
